    The Real Cost of Diabetic Neuropathy Footwear Mismanagement

    Diabetic neuropathy is a common complication of diabetes, affecting a significant portion of the diabetic population. For occupational therapists managing patients with this condition, prescribing appropriate footwear becomes a critical aspect of their treatment plan.

    The manual process of writing these prescriptions is time-consuming and requires thorough understanding of the patient's specific needs, including their foot shape, pressure points, and sensitivity levels. This detailed assessment ensures that the prescribed footwear provides adequate support, reduces friction, and minimizes the risk of complications such as ulcers and infections.

    However, when this process is rushed or done inaccurately, it can lead to discomfort for the patient, increased risk of complications, and potential delays in wound healing. The financial implications of mismanaged diabetic neuropathy footwear prescriptions are significant, as incorrect footwear can result in longer recovery times, increased use of resources like bandages and antibiotics, and potentially higher costs associated with treating complications.

    Yes, but you must take strict data security precautions. Never paste patient Personally Identifiable Information (PII), specific dates, names, or proprietary facility guidelines into public AI engines like ChatGPT. Always replace sensitive patient and chart details with generalized bracketed placeholders (e.g., [Patient Name]) and only run the prompts using anonymized clinical facts to ensure compliance with HIPAA regulations.
